Laboratories of democracy is a phrase popularized by U.S. Supreme Court Justice Louis Brandeis in New State Ice Co. v. Liebmann to describe how "a single courageous State may, if its citizens choose, serve as a laboratory; and try novel social and economic experiments without risk to the rest of the country." Brandeis was an associate justice of the Supreme Court of the United States from 1916 to 1939. WebMay 7, 2024 · In doing so, they will become the laboratory of democracy Justice Brandeis described. The individual states in the United States Are sometimes called “laboratories of democracy” because they can experiment with innovative policy ideas. This allows other states and the nation as a whole to see if the new ideas work or not before they adopt them. dwarf fortress water evaporationWebFeb 11, 2024 · Ensight Laboratories, Llc is a provider established in Blythewood, South Carolina operating as a Clinical Medical Laboratory.
